0

jquery を使用して、個々のリストを並べ替えたり、リスト間で並べ替えたりできます。ただし、両方を実行しようとすると、個別の並べ替えはうまく機能しません。(最後にしか余裕がないらしい) リーの幅を指定することに関係しているようです。何か案は。みんなありがとう - 私はあまりにも長い間苦労してきました. ウェブサイトは次のとおりです。 http://s95311055.onlinehome.us/midwives2012/sortFields-test.php

jquery

$(function() {
 $( "#category1, #category2" ).sortable({items: "li:not(.ui-state-disabled)",connectWith: "#removed"}).disableSelection();   

});

CSS

._32 {
 width: 28%;
display: inline;
float: left;
padding-left: 2%;
padding-right: 2%;
padding-bottom: 2%;
margin:5px;
background-color: #FFC; 

}

          <ul class="category" id="category1"><span class="categoryHeader">List1<br></span>
  <li class="_32">num1</li>    
  <li class="_32">num2</li>    
  <li class="_32">num3</li>    
  <li class="_32">num4</li>    
  <li class="_32">num5</li>    
  <li class="_32">num6</li>                                  
  <li class="_32">num7</li>    
  <li class="_32">num8</li>    
  <li class="_32">num9</li>    
  <li class="_32">num10</li>    
  <li class="_32">num11</li>    
  <li class="_32">num12</li>        
</ul>
<ul class="category" id="category2"><span class="categoryHeader">List2<br></span>
  <li class="_32">num21</li>    
  <li class="_32">num22</li>    
  <li class="_32">num23</li>    
  <li class="_32">num24</li>    
  <li class="_32">num25</li>    
  <li class="_32">num26</li>                                  
  <li class="_32">num27</li>    
  <li class="_32">num28</li>    
  <li class="_32">num29</li>    
  <li class="_32">num30</li>    
  <li class="_32">num31</li>    
  <li class="_32">num32</li>        

</ul> 
4

1 に答える 1

1

あなたの問題は、jquery sortable の既知の問題です。バグレポートはこちら

于 2013-02-20T09:16:32.510 に答える